    Misty Copeland’s and Tiler Peck’s New Advice Books for the Next Generation

    For younger dancers, having a mentor is usually a lifesaver. However not each scholar has entry to that one dancer on the studio with the proper recommendation for each state of affairs—the form of knowledge that comes from lived expertise.

    American Ballet Theatre principal Misty Copeland and New York Metropolis Ballet principal Tiler Peck, having reached nice heights in their very own dance careers, are serving to to fill that hole. Lately, they each wrote books that lend a serving to hand to youthful dancers—or youngsters with any pursuits—by offering suggestions, how-tos, and anecdotes on navigating younger life. Letters to Misty (Simon & Schuster, Could 2025) and XO Ballerina Massive Sis (Penguin Random Home, October 2025) are books that readers can end in a single sitting or reference after they want some pro-dancer knowledge.

    Right here’s some extra information about each of those thrilling new books you possibly can add to your fall studying checklist:

    Misty Copeland, Letters to Misty

    Cowl courtesy of Simon and Schuster.

    Copeland has printed 10 books for youngsters, younger adults, and adults thus far. Her newest middle-grade guide is Letters to Misty: How to Move Through Life with Confidence and Grace. Co-written with creator Nikki Shannon Smith, the guide reads like {a magazine}’s recommendation column, with Copeland answering questions on matters that may be utilized to bop or to life basically. The guide is break up into 5 sections, every equivalent to one of many positions of the toes and arms in classical ballet.

    Copeland weaves private anecdotes in together with her recommendation. When answering a query about making associates, she tells the story of how she met Catalina, one among her oldest associates, when she simply began coaching at her first ballet college. She shares how in her friendship with Catalina, she feels secure sufficient to be herself, and emphasizes that as an vital attribute in any relationship. Whereas Copeland typically refers again to her ballet coaching and profession for examples, Letters to Misty focuses on life recommendation that may be related to any younger individual going by way of a interval of self-discovery and progress.

    Tiler Peck, XO Ballerina Massive Sis

    Book cover: Tiler Peck, in a red dress, sits against a pink background in a spotlight, with reddish pink and teal text
    Cowl courtesy of Penguin Random Home.

    Peck can also be no stranger to writing, having printed the middle-grade novels Katarina Ballerina (Simon & Schuster, 2020) and Katarina Ballerina & the Victory Dance (2021). Her newest, XO Ballerina Big Sis, is written with co-author Leslie Tonner and is Peck’s first nonfiction work. Devoted followers may discover that the guide, which has a tone as heat and pleasant as Peck’s on-line voice, relies on her social media video collection of the identical identify.

    In an interview with Pointe, Peck shared that XO Ballerina Massive Sis covers every little thing she needs she knew when she was youthful: “I didn’t need youngsters to really feel alone in the event that they weren’t raised in a dance household.” The books’ matters vary from tying pointe shoe ribbons to dealing with competitors in a wholesome method. Peck says that the guide, whereas aimed toward performers ages 8 by way of 12, is devoted “to each younger dancer with large goals.”
